penetratione
Penetratione is a Latin grammatical form, the ablative singular of the noun penetratio, meaning "penetration" or "entry." In classical and later Latin texts the ablative case expresses a range of relationships such as means, manner, cause or accompaniment, so penetratione would typically be translated as "by/with/through penetration" or "in regard to penetration" depending on context.
